What skills and experience we're looking for

Would you like to join in a popular, oversubscribed school that CARES, where Community, Ambition, Resilience, Effort and Success are valued, all within a safe, supportive and inclusive learning environment?

We wish to appoint an enthusiastic and ambitious Teacher of Science to teach across KS3 to KS4 from April/September 2025. There is also a potential for a job share TLR 2b at 0.5fte for KS3 Science Coordinator. The Science Faculty has state of the art facilities including 8 science classroom laboratories and an ICT suite.

The successful candidate will have the ability to teach across all age and ability ranges. You will be an effective classroom teacher with the ability to raise the achievement of all students and be keen to play a full part in the life of the school.

Applications from ECTs are welcome as the school has a strong ECT training and support programme.

Prendergast Ladywell School is part of the Leathersellers’ Federation of Schools; we believe that all our students can achieve excellence and that they deserve the very best teachers and resources to reach their potential. Our caring environment values achievement and we insist on tolerance and mutual respect.

If you are someone who puts students first and is prepared to go the extra mile for every one of our students, then we want to hear from you.

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
